Jamaican Coco Bread Recipe

Ingredients:

2 packets yeast (4 1/2 tsp.)
1 tsp. sugar
1/4 c. warm water
1 medium egg
1 c. warm milk
1 tsp. salt
3 1/2 c. white flour
1/2 c. melted butter

Directions:

Mix yeast, sugar, and water together. Beat the egg and stir into mixture. Stir in milk and salt. Stir in 2 c. flour. Slowly add more flour, stop when mixture becomes stiff. Knead the dough until it is smooth, about 10 min. Transfer dough to a clean buttered bowl. Roll the dough around the bowl until coated in butter. Cover with damp towel for 1 hour. Divide dough into 10 pieces and roll each piece into a circle, about 1/2 cm. thick. Brush the dough with melted butter, then fold in half. Preheat oven to 425º. Place folded pieces on well greased sheet and place on the bottom rack of the oven. Bake until golden brown (about 15 min).
